excel怎么制作分班软件下载

excel怎么制作分班软件下载

一、在Excel中制作分班软件下载的核心步骤是:创建数据表格、编写VBA代码、用户界面设计、导出为可执行文件。 其中,编写VBA代码是最为重要的一步,通过编写VBA代码可以实现自动化分班操作,提高效率并减少人为错误。

二、创建数据表格

在Excel中制作分班软件下载的第一步是创建一个数据表格。这一步至关重要,因为数据表格是整个操作的基础。以下是创建数据表格的详细步骤:

1. 学生信息表

创建一个工作表,用于存储学生的基本信息。表格应包括以下列:学生姓名、学号、性别、成绩等。你可以根据具体需求添加其他列,例如班级、出生日期、联系方式等。

2. 分班规则表

创建另一个工作表,用于存储分班规则。这些规则可以包括班级人数上限、性别比例、成绩分布等。分班规则表有助于在分班过程中自动化处理各种限制条件。

三、编写VBA代码

在Excel中,VBA(Visual Basic for Applications)是一种强大的编程语言,可以用来自动化任务。以下是编写VBA代码的详细步骤:

1. 启用开发工具

首先,确保Excel中的开发工具选项卡是可见的。如果没有看到开发工具选项卡,可以通过以下步骤启用:

  • 点击“文件”菜单
  • 选择“选项”
  • 在“自定义功能区”选项卡中,勾选“开发工具”选项

2. 创建VBA模块

在开发工具选项卡中,点击“Visual Basic”按钮,打开VBA编辑器。在VBA编辑器中,插入一个新的模块:

  • 点击“插入”菜单
  • 选择“模块”

3. 编写分班代码

在新模块中,编写分班代码。代码应根据分班规则表中的规则,将学生信息表中的学生分配到不同的班级。例如,你可以编写一个循环来遍历所有学生,并根据他们的成绩和性别,将他们分配到合适的班级。

Sub 分班()

Dim ws学生信息 As Worksheet

Dim ws分班规则 As Worksheet

Dim r学生 As Range

Dim r规则 As Range

Dim 班级人数上限 As Integer

Dim 班级() As Collection

Dim i As Integer, j As Integer

Dim 学生 As Variant

' 获取工作表

Set ws学生信息 = ThisWorkbook.Sheets("学生信息")

Set ws分班规则 = ThisWorkbook.Sheets("分班规则")

' 获取分班规则

班级人数上限 = ws分班规则.Range("A2").Value

' 初始化班级

ReDim 班级(1 To 4)

For i = 1 To 4

Set 班级(i) = New Collection

Next i

' 遍历所有学生

For Each r学生 In ws学生信息.Range("A2:A" & ws学生信息.Cells(ws学生信息.Rows.Count, 1).End(xlUp).Row)

学生 = Array(r学生.Offset(0, 0).Value, r学生.Offset(0, 1).Value, r学生.Offset(0, 2).Value)

' 根据规则分配学生到班级

For i = 1 To 4

If 班级(i).Count < 班级人数上限 Then

班级(i).Add 学生

Exit For

End If

Next i

Next r学生

' 输出分班结果

For i = 1 To 4

For j = 1 To 班级(i).Count

ws学生信息.Cells(j + 1, 5 + i).Value = 班级(i)(j)(0)

Next j

Next i

End Sub

四、用户界面设计

为了使分班软件下载更加用户友好,我们可以设计一个简单的用户界面。以下是设计用户界面的详细步骤:

1. 创建按钮

在工作表中插入一个按钮,用于触发分班操作。可以通过以下步骤插入按钮:

  • 在开发工具选项卡中,点击“插入”按钮
  • 选择“按钮(窗体控件)”
  • 在工作表中绘制按钮

2. 关联VBA代码

右键点击按钮,选择“指定宏”,然后选择我们之前编写的“分班”宏。这样,当用户点击按钮时,就会自动执行分班操作。

3. 美化界面

为了提高用户体验,可以对工作表进行一些美化。例如,可以使用条件格式来突出显示不同班级的学生,或者添加一些说明文字,帮助用户更好地理解操作流程。

五、导出为可执行文件

为了方便用户使用,可以将Excel文件导出为可执行文件。以下是导出为可执行文件的详细步骤:

1. 保存为Excel宏启用工作簿

首先,将Excel文件保存为Excel宏启用工作簿(.xlsm)格式。这样可以确保VBA代码能够正常运行。

2. 使用第三方工具

可以使用一些第三方工具,将Excel文件转换为可执行文件。例如,可以使用“XLtoEXE”工具,将Excel文件打包为一个独立的可执行文件。这样,用户无需安装Excel即可运行分班软件下载。

3. 测试和发布

在发布之前,务必对可执行文件进行充分的测试,确保其在不同的环境下都能正常运行。测试完成后,可以将文件上传到公司网站或其他分发平台,供用户下载使用。

六、总结

通过以上步骤,我们可以在Excel中制作一个功能强大的分班软件下载。创建数据表格、编写VBA代码、用户界面设计、导出为可执行文件,每一步都至关重要。通过合理设计和充分测试,可以确保分班软件下载的稳定性和易用性,提高工作效率并减少人为错误。

相关问答FAQs:

1. 分班软件下载的步骤是什么?

  • 首先,你可以在搜索引擎中输入关键词“分班软件下载”来查找可靠的下载源。
  • 然后,浏览下载源,找到适合你需求的分班软件。
  • 接下来,点击下载按钮,等待软件下载完成。
  • 最后,双击下载的软件安装包,按照提示完成软件的安装。

2. 有哪些值得推荐的分班软件可以下载?

  • 分班软件有很多种类,具体的推荐会根据你的需求而有所不同。有一些常见的分班软件如:Classroom Spy、Edusync、ClassDojo等。你可以根据自己的需求和软件的功能特点来选择合适的软件。

3. 分班软件下载后,如何使用它来进行分班操作?

  • 下载和安装分班软件后,打开软件并登录或注册一个账户。
  • 根据软件提供的指引,创建一个新的班级或导入已有的班级信息。
  • 在班级管理界面,可以设置学生的信息,例如姓名、学号等。
  • 根据学生的不同特点,可以使用软件提供的筛选和排序功能进行分班操作。
  • 最后,将分班结果保存并导出,以便后续使用。

4. 分班软件可以在哪些方面帮助我?

  • 分班软件可以帮助你快速准确地进行学生的分班操作,节省了大量的人工分班时间和精力。
  • 通过分班软件,你可以根据学生的不同特点进行灵活的分班,比如按照成绩、兴趣爱好、能力水平等进行分类。
  • 分班软件还可以帮助你统计和分析学生的数据,提供有关班级整体情况和个别学生表现的报告,方便你进行教学和管理工作。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4978555

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部